Moment: Отсутствуют файлы локали en и en-US

Созданный на 4 дек. 2014  ·  3Комментарии  ·  Источник: moment/moment

Я понимаю, что это может быть язык по умолчанию, но было бы удобно, если бы в источнике были справочные файлы (даже пустые) для этих двух локалей.

В лучшем случае можно ожидать 404 для некоторых реализаций, которые динамически переключают локали, но в моем случае мне нужно создать список подмножества локалей, поддерживаемых как AngularJS, так и MomentJS — к сожалению, «en» и «en-US» не Незнаю конечно.

Как насчет пары пустых файлов с простым текстом /* по умолчанию */?

Самый полезный комментарий

Где я могу проверить набор настроек по умолчанию для локали "en"?

Все 3 Комментарий

Я согласен, что это не симметрично, но я не думаю, что мы когда-нибудь будем ставить «en» и «en-US» отдельно. Также я не думаю, что размещение пустого файла - хорошая идея - просто случается так, что ваш алгоритм использует имена файлов, кто-то другой может попытаться обнаружить вызовы defineLocale...

Просто добавьте «en-US» в список локалей (вы пишете алгоритм). en — это просто псевдоним для en-US .

Где я могу проверить набор настроек по умолчанию для локали "en"?

@codemole986 lib/locale/base-config.js

Была ли эта страница полезной?
0 / 5 - 0 рейтинги